All'interno della Divisione Spazio , per l’unità organizzativa Product Quality, stiamo ricercando un/a Quality Control ( Inspection ), per la nostra sede di Nerviano (MI) . La persona, all’interno del team di Hardware Quality, verifica la conformità di unità, sottoassiemi, componenti e trattamenti in accordo ai requisiti di Qualità e agli standard applicabili; intercetta, identifica e gestisce il prodotto non conforme ed effettua i controlli che abilitano alle successive fasi di integrazione e all’attuazione del KIP; supporta PAM e il QA durante le fasi di ispezione KIP/MIP. La persona si occuperà delle seguenti attività: Ispezionare preformatura, degolging e pretinning dei componenti elettronici (Vapour Phase); Ispezionare il PCB prima e dopo il montaggio (Vapour Phase/Hand Soldering); Ispezionare il prodotto dopo le rilavorazioni; Interfacciarsi con il QA se rileva difetti eccessivi, border line o critici; Ispezionare la scheda elettronica assiemata, ossia integrata con la sua meccanica; Aprire NCR per sostituzione di parti difettose e supporta la relativa NRB. Il QC Spazio in ambito elettronico è certificato in accordo alle norme ECSS ed è certificato CAT. 2.
